Multi-gluon correlations in the Color Glass Condensate
Abstract
The Color Glass Condensate is a universal state of matter which can manifest itself in hadronic processes involving small-x partons, like DIS and pp, pA and AA collisions at high energy. Observables are given in terms of multi-gluon correlators, whose ensemble evolves according to a RG equation, the JIMWLK equation. We focus on recent progress towards its solution which lead to quasi-exact, analytic expressions for the multi-gluon correlators at high energy.
